The inspector’s account

On 01/30/2026 at 11:30AM,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Andrew Christy arrived unannounced to conduct the 1-Year Annual Required inspection. LPA met with Administrator, Jean Holt, and explained the purpose of the visit. The facility currently houses two (2) residents with a max capacity of six (6) residents.

LPA toured facility including but not limited to bedrooms, bathrooms, kitchen, common area and backyard. All outdoor and indoor passageways are kept free of obstruction. No bodies of water were observed. A comfortable indoor temperature is maintained at 71.0 degrees Fahrenheit. The hot water temperature in the residents’ shared bathroom was measured at 125.5 degrees Fahrenheit. LPA observed lighting in all rooms are adequate for the comfort and safety of the residents. Residents’ bathrooms are equipped with grab bars and non-skid mats. There is a minimum of one week supply of non-perishable and 2 day of perishable foods. Centrally stored medication and sharps were locked and inaccessible to residents. Smoke detectors and carbon monoxide detectors were in operating condition during visit. Fire extinguisher was last serviced on 04/24/2024.

At 12:30PM, LPA reviewed two (2) resident file and one (1) staff files. The emergency disaster plan was last reviewed 01/30/2026. Quarterly emergency drills were last conducted 12/02/2025. A review of resident medications and the Medication Administration Record (MAR) found no outstanding errors.
